Topic: Training aid idea Posted: 25 Jan 20 at 4:17pm |
This not intended as something to be a commercial product just a bit of fun. It stared with thinking about speed through tacks and wouldn’t it be good if to knew that you were slowing down, by how much and then use this information to improve your technique. I figure that a system that would work would be an audio system, initially thinking that beeps would get closer together as you sped up and further apart as you slow down. This would only really work if it was comparing relative speed over the past den seconds say. This would ensure it works at two knots and twenty knots. I have started messing about with Arduino programming and it seams relatively easy. I’m thinking supper simple. You have a piece of rope tie it to the rudder stock and throw it overboard, near the boat end is a small container with the electronics and the speaker, the outboard end has a spinner, think Walker log. I appreciate there are all sorts of fancy pucks with logging and readout but this is just about in the moment understanding what is happening to your speed without looking at a display Any thoughts would be appreciated, again nothing commercial just a bit of fun. |

I think you’d learn more from a GoPro mounted in your boat filming your movement through a manoeuvre. The problem with speed reading is you’d have to either watch a speedo, therefore stopping you concentrate on actually what makes a good manoeuvre or pulling through lots of speed traces on computer then trying to work out what you did in each one.
